MB wrote: > Timing chains usually need looking at around 90-100k milles - or so I thought? > Still, it was done when the engine was out for the head gasket, so was really only the price > of the chain, and no extra labour on a job which was big anyway. Not in my exprience - I've had a fair few 900s and 9000s with well over 150k on the original chain, with no visible wear. I know of many with over 250k on the original chain. If the engine was really out, then I'd agree - you may as well change the chain. But why was the engine out for a head gasket job? > I know what you mean about the shape though.
